#24dd80 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#24dd80 is composed of 14.1% red, 86.7%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.1%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 149.8 degrees, a saturation of 73.1% and a lightness of 50.4%. #24dd80 color hex could be obtained by blending #48ffff with #00bb01.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#24dd80

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#f0fd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#24dd80

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c8580 is the less saturated color, while #07fa80 is the most saturated one.
